CUCUMBER TOMATO SALAD ZUCCHINI AND BLACK OLIVES

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 large cucumbers, diced
1 zucchini, diced
1/2 red onion, thinly sliced
3 large tomatoes, diced
1 cup chopped black olives
2 tablespoons chopped fresh basil
2 teaspoons fresh thyme leaves
3 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1 tablespoon balsamic vinega
1 1/2 teaspoons lemon zest
1/2 lemon, juiced
1 1/4 teaspoons kosher salt, or to taste
1/2 teaspoon white sugar
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• 1. In a large salad bowl, mix together the cucumbers, zucchini, red onion, tomatoes, black olives, basil, and thyme. In a separate bowl, whisk together the red wine vinegar, balsamic vinegar, lemon zest, lemon juice, kosher salt, sugar, and white pepper until thoroughly combined. Pour the olive oil slowly into the dressing mixture, whisking to combine. Pour the dressing over the salad, and serve.

ZUCCHINI AND CUCUMBER SALAD

Mmmmm....zucchini and cucumber marinated in an oil and balsamic vinegar dressing kicked up with olives, cherry tomatoes and dijon mustard! Adapted from Country Home magazine.

Time 10m

Yield 5 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 lb small zucchini, thinly sliced
1/2 large English cucumber,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1 large sweet onion, cut into thin rings
1 (2 1/4 ounce) can black olives, pitted and sliced
1/2 cup cherry tomatoes
1/4 cup loosely packed fresh Italian parsley
1/3 cup extra virgin olive oil
1/4 cup cider vinegar
1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
1 teaspoon dijon-style mustard
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on hot pepper sauce
1 garlic clove, minced
1/8 teaspoon black pepper

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ine zucchini, cucumber, onion, olives, tomatoes, and parsley.
  • For the dressing, whisk together oil, vinegars, mustard, salt, hot pepper sauce, garlic, and pepper. Add to zucchini mixture; toss to coat. Season to taste with more salt and pepper, if needed. Cover and chill up to 24 hours.
  • Makes 5 servings.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 192.4, Fat 16.2, SaturatedFat 2.3, Sodium 354.2, Carbohydrate 10.8, Fiber 2.3, Sugar 6.4, Protein 2.1

TOMATO CUCUMBER SALAD II

A simple recipe for a fresh tasting summer salad. Wonderful with tomatoes fresh from the garden!

Time 15m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

4 medium fresh tomatoes, cut into 1 inch chunks
1 large cucumber, sliced
½ red onion, diced
¼ cup mayonnaise
2 cloves garlic, minced
2 teaspoons fresh ground black pepper
salt to taste

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, toss together the tomatoes, cucumber, onion, mayonnaise, and garlic. Season with pepper and salt.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 141.8 calories, Carbohydrate 10.3 g, Cholesterol 5.2 mg, Fat 11.3 g, Fiber 2.4 g, Protein 2 g, SaturatedFat 1.7 g, Sodium 86.9 mg, Sugar 5.2 g
